Ticket: Gustline fan-out config drift

Prod fan-out workers are dropping alerts under load. Staging isn't. Diff shows prod still has pre-migration concurrency settings — someone skipped the Gustline 2.3 config sync. Reminder for new folks: configs live in the manifest repo, not on hosts. Reapply the canonical block and cycle the workers. Expected values follow.

deployment values, kajep-kageg:
[praix]
host = praix.paliqcorp.corp
user = praix_svc
database = praix_prod

Ticket: Crashlog pipeline for the Fernwhistle mobile app is silently dropping reports again. Turns out staging got deployed with the prod ingest URL but the wrong auth, so every upload 403s and the retry queue is ballooning. Classic misconfigured env. Fix is easy: point INGEST_URL back at the staging collector and regenerate the pipeline credential from the Fernwhistle admin panel. Then update the worker's .env — the ingest endpoint var first, and directly below it the secret, set on the next line.

vault entry, yahif-yajep: COURIER_KEY29=b802bdf8034096b65a51c6ba5abe2

Welcome to Brindlewood Systems! If you need a spare keyboard, cable, or monitor, the storage room on level 2 (next to the Fernbank kitchen) is your friend. Just don't prop the door open, and log anything you take on the clipboard inside. The keypad code you'll need is below.

turnstile pass: bdg-FVNQRS-72965873

Alert: CronMigrator flagged a job still running on the old scheduler. Heads up for new folks — we're moving all cron jobs at Fernwhistle over to the Larkline workflow engine, and this alert fires whenever a legacy job executes. Usually it just means someone forgot to delete the old crontab entry after migrating. Check the migration tracker first before paging anyone; the full checklist lives at the internal page below.

wiki page, tagef-kahop: https://artifactory.xolmartech.internal/browse/dash/build/dash/2cc0ce10c67daee1